Find the weed edge in 1–3 m water — that's where redfin school. Cast bibbed minnows parallel to the weed line on a fast jerky retrieve. For big "stripies" (>1 kg / 1.5 lb), drop-shot a 4" soft plastic vertically on schools showing on sounder in 5–10 m on lakes Eildon, Mulwala, Hume, Cairn Curran. Fish move shallower in autumn and spring as water warms past 12°C, deeper in midsummer when surface temps push 22°C+.
Lake levels matter — falling lake levels concentrate fish into old creek beds and channels where bait gets stranded. After consistent rain or in early spring as water warms past 12°C, schools become very active. Stable barometric pressure for 24 hours pre-fishing is the trigger.
Less moon-influenced than trout — time of day matters more. Dawn and dusk patrol the weed lines; midday they go deep. Cloudy days produce longer feeding windows than clear-sky days.
DECLARED NOXIOUS PEST in VIC, NSW, ACT, TAS, WA — by law you must NOT return them to the water alive. No bag or size limit in most states (because of pest status), but you must humanely dispatch each fish (firm blow to the back of the head with an iki spike or priest) and not release. Bowfishing legal for redfin in some VIC waters. Always verify state-specific rules at VFA / NSW DPI / DPIRD WA / IFS Tas — pest fish handling rules have legal teeth.
